Zee TVs ongoing show Ganga Mai Ki Betiyan continues to explore the challenges faced by Ganga, played by Shubhangi Latkar, as she attempts to rebuild her life after a series of setbacks. The ongoing storyline recently saw Ganga lose her beloved Dhaba in a fire, prompting her to take part in a cooking competition in an effort to revive her dream. Although Ganga does not win the competition, the story takes an unexpected turn when the winner decides to give her the Rs. 20 lakhs prize money. The gesture comes after the winner acknowledges the role Gangas guidance and support played in her victory. The money gives Ganga an opportunity to rebuild her Dhaba and restore a part of the life she had lost. For Shubhangi Latkar, Gangas response to these setbacks has also offered an opportunity to reflect on her own experiences. The actor said that while she has not faced circumstances identical to those of her character, she understands the experience of having to start over. Playing Ganga has made me look at my own journey differently. What inspires me most about her is the way she refuses to let difficult circumstances hold her back. I may not have experienced the situations she faces, but I understand the feeling of having to start again and find your way forward. There have been times in my own life when things havent gone as planned, but Ganga constantly reminds me that giving up is never the answer. Her determination to keep moving ahead, no matter how many challenges come her way, is something I deeply admire. Portraying her has made me realise that sometimes, the biggest strength comes from simply choosing to continue. I hope Gangas journey gives viewers the same sense of hope and reminds them that every setback can be a new beginning, she said. With the Rs. 20 lakh prize money now available to her, Ganga is expected to focus on restoring the Dhaba. However, another conflict is developing within her family. Murli, played by Rohin Joshi, and Sahana, portrayed by Namrata Pradhan, begin facing difficulties in their relationship after Murlis mother creates misunderstandings between the couple. As tensions increase within the family, the upcoming episodes will explore whether Ganga steps in to support Sahana and helps her deal with the situation. The track is set to add another layer to Gangas role within the family as she works towards rebuilding her own life. Ganga Mai Ki Betiyan stars Amandeep Sidhu as Sneha and Sheizaan Khan as Siddhu in the lead roles, alongside Shubhangi Latkar, Rohin Joshi and Namrata Pradhan. Bandar OTT release: Bobby Deol starrer Anurag Kashyap directorial to premiere on Zee 5 on August 28
Anurag Kashyaps directorial Bandar is set to make its digital premiere on Zee 5 on August 28, 2026. The crime drama, which stars Bobby Deol in the lead along with Sanya Malhotra, Sapna Pabbi and Saba Azad, explores themes of accusation, public perception, media scrutiny and justice. Produced by Saffron Magicworks and Zee Studios, Bandar follows Samar Mehra, a former television actor whose life changes after he is accused of rape by a former partner. As the allegation leads to intense media attention and a legal battle, the film examines the consequences of being judged publicly before the complete picture emerges. The film has been positioned around the #MeTooForMen discourse and raises questions about victimhood, consent and the role of public opinion in cases involving serious allegations. Rather than presenting a straightforward narrative, Bandar explores the grey areas surrounding its central conflict and follows the impact of an accusation on the people involved. Speaking about the film and its central premise, director Anurag Kashyap said, What drew me to this story was its willingness to ask difficult questions, including one that society is often uncomfortable confronting: can men be victims too? The film challenges audiences to look beyond black-and-white narratives and consider the uncomfortable grey areas that often exist in real life. It asks whether we are truly willing to listen before we judge, and whether our understanding of victimhood, truth and empathy is sometimes influenced by our own assumptions. The film is anchored by some exceptional performances, especially from Bobby, who completely immersed himself in the character and brought a vulnerability and intensity that the role demanded. Whatever the journey of the film may have been so far, I believe the story remains relevant and worthy of discussion. I'm glad that Bandar will now reach a wider audience on Hindi Zee 5, and I hope viewers engage with it, interpret it in their own way, and keep the conversation going long after the film ends. Bobby Deol, who plays Samar, said, Bandar was one of those rare projects that pushed me completely out of my comfort zone. The character demanded a lot from me, not just as an actor, but as a person. I had to let go of my inhibitions, trust the process, and fully surrender to Anurag's vision. What I love about Anurag's storytelling is that he never takes the obvious route. He encourages you to explore the uncomfortable, the unexpected, and that's what made this journey so rewarding. Playing this role was both challenging and liberating, and I thoroughly enjoyed every moment of it. The film has a special place in my heart and I'm hopeful that its premiere on Hindi Zee 5 will give it the wider audience it deserves and allow more viewers to experience this unique story. Sapna Pabbi, who plays Gayatri, added, Bandar has been one of the most special experiences of my career. When Anurag sir approached me for Gayatri, I was instantly drawn to how layered and unpredictable she was. Characters like her don't come around very often. Gayatri is a complex character whose actions set the story in motion, and portraying her was both emotionally demanding and deeply rewarding. What I appreciated most was the trust Anurag sir placed in me and the freedom he gave me to explore the many shades of the character. I'm delighted that the film will now find a wider audience on Hindi Zee 5 and I am looking forward to more people watching this unconventional story. Sanya Malhotra said, Bandar is the kind of film that sparks conversations and encourages you to look at situations from different perspectives. It's a story that raises thought-provoking questions and stays with you long after you've watched it. I'm delighted that the film is now coming to Hindi Zee 5, giving audiences across the globe an opportunity to experience it and engage with its powerful themes. Directed by Anurag Kashyap, Bandar features Bobby Deol, Sanya Malhotra, Sapna Pabbi, Saba Azad, Indrajith Sukumaran, Raj B. Shetty and Jitendra Joshi, among others. The film is produced by Saffron Magicworks and Zee Studios and will stream exclusively on Zee 5 from August 28. Prime Videos The Traitors Season 2 has emerged as the streaming services No. 1 non-English title worldwide during its launch week. The second season of the reality series premiered on August 13 and has also ranked among Prime Videos Top 10 Prime Original series globally, according to the platform. Hosted and produced for the second season by Karan Johar, The Traitors Season 2 brings together 21 celebrity Players from different fields. Set against the backdrop of Suryagarh Palace, the series revolves around a game of deception in which a group of secretly selected Traitors attempts to remain undetected while the Innocents work to identify and eliminate them. Speaking about the response to the new season, Karan Johar said, Judging by the response to the first three episodes, we can safely say audiences are thoroughly enjoying the dhokha. And theres plenty more paranoia, plotting, betrayal, and, of course, some spectacularly bad decisions coming their way, which Im sure theyll love. Not just the Players, but everyone watching seems to have a theory, and with every elimination, those theories are thrown out the window. The unpredictable nature of the show is what keeps audiences on the edge of their seats, making the show as engaging as it is entertaining. The season features Aaditya Kulshreshth (Kullu), Abhishek Malhan (Fukraa Insaan), Ansh Chopra, Dalip Tahil, Harman Singha, Ikka Singh, Karan Singh Magic, Krystle Dsouza, Mallika Sherawat, Munawar Faruqui, Parul Gulati, Prish, Ranveer Brar, Rhea Chakraborty, Rida Tharana, Sahil Salathia, Shahneel Gill, Shalini Passi, Shweta Tiwari, Soundous Moufakir and Tanya Puri. The format places the Players in a setting where alliances and suspicions can change rapidly. While the Traitors must deceive the other contestants and avoid detection, the Innocents are tasked with identifying them before they are eliminated. The changing dynamics and eliminations form the central conflict of the series. Nikhil Madhok, Director and Head of Originals, Prime Video (SVOD) and Amazon MGM Studios India, said, The response to Season 2 of The Traitors has been phenomenal, and witnessing the enthusiasm and engagement with which audiences have embraced this season is incredibly gratifying. When a show takes over the internet and sparks heated conversations on social media, with fans passionately choosing sides and rooting for their favorite Players, you know youve got audiences hooked. The season has only just begun, and were confident the love and excitement will only grow in the weeks to come. The Indian adaptation is produced by Dharmatic Entertainment in collaboration with independent distributor All3Media International and is based on IDTVs BAFTA and Emmy Award-winning global format. Mona Singh is one of the most talented performers in the Indian entertainment space, effortlessly moving between comedy, drama, and emotionally layered characters. But do you know that she never underwent professional training in acting? Interestingly, Monas journey into acting began with her active participation in school and college, where she explored different forms of performance. Recalling her early years and how television became her learning ground, Mona Singh shared, When I was in school and college, I used to participate in skits and school acts. I would write and direct them, and I used to dance a lot as well. I was actively involved in most of the dramas in school, but I never had any professional training. I think television is that kind of ground that teaches you everythingit teaches you about lighting, your marks, continuity, and so much more. Im a quick learner. So, while it wasnt easy for me, I was willing to learn and be open to every kind of experience during Jassi. It was this willingness to learn, adapt and, embrace every experience that helped Mona carve her own path as a performer. From Jassi Jaissi Koi Nahin to an impressive range of roles across television, streaming and films, she has consistently demonstrated an instinctive understanding of her characters, backed by the ability to constantly evolve as an actor. What makes her journey even more remarkable is that her craft has been built through experience, observation and an openness to learn. 2026 has been another defining year for Mona, with the actor taking on six different characters, each distinct in personality, world and emotional landscape. View this post on Instagram A post shared by Lin Laishram (@linlaishram) Randeep and Lin first met through veteran actor Naseeruddin Shahs theatre group Motley. Their relationship grew over time, and the couple began living together during the COVID-19 lockdown. The couple got married on November 29, 2023, in a traditional Meitei ceremony in Manipur. They welcomed their daughter Nyomica in March. Randeep had earlier shared that their daughter was born on his fathers birthday, making the day particularly meaningful for the family. On the work front, Randeep is set to appear in Eetha alongside Shraddha Kapoor. The film is inspired by the life of one of Indias earliest Tamasha/Lavni dancers and explores a culturally rooted story. He will also headline the epic war drama Operation Khukri. Randeep has secured the official movie rights to Operation Khukri: The Untold Story of the Indian Armys Bravest Peacekeeping Mission Abroad, written by Major General Rajpal Punia and Damini Punia. The film will depict the events of 2000, when 233 Indian soldiers were held hostage by rebel forces in Sierra Leone, West Africa, followed by a high-risk rescue operation. From Awarapan 2 To Gunmaaster G9, Emraan Hashmis next act looks interestingly well-timed
There is something quietly smart about Deepak Mukut announcing Gunmaaster G9 for November 2026 just days after Awarapan 2 arrived in theatres and began doing brisk business. The timing could easily have been read as an attempt to capitalise on Emraan Hashmi's renewed theatrical momentum. But the 3-month gap suggests something more measured. Gunmaaster G9 isn't being rushed into theatres to ride the Awarapan 2 wave. It has time to become its own film. And that could be its biggest advantage. Because Awarapan 2 has done something useful for Hashmi: it has reminded audiences that he still works as a theatrical lead. Not as the Emraan Hashmi of the mid-2000s. Not by recreating the serial kisser image or leaning entirely on nostalgia. But as an actor whose screen presence, intensity and familiarity still have value when the material connects. That makes Gunmaaster G9 an intriguing next step. G9 doesn't need to chase Awarapan 2 The biggest mistake the makers could make now would be to treat Gunmaaster G9 as a follow-up to Awarapan 2. It isn't. And the November 2026 release gives the film enough breathing room to establish its own identity. By then, Awarapan 2 will no longer be the film Hashmi has to be measured against. Its performance will simply be another chapter in his career. Gunmaaster G9 can therefore be presented on its own merits as an action entertainer with Hashmi at the centre rather than as the next instalment in a so-called comeback narrative. That distinction matters. Audiences are quick to sense when a film is being sold on momentum alone. They are equally quick to move on. G9 has the opportunity to avoid that trap. Why the November 2026 date makes sense An action film needs time, particularly when scale and production value are part of the proposition. The extended runway allows Mukut and the team to get the film right rather than simply get it out. It also creates a useful distance from Awarapan 2. Instead of having Hashmi appear on screen again while audiences are still processing his previous performance, G9 can arrive after anticipation has had time to rebuild. There is another advantage: the film can create its own marketing narrative. Hashmi's presence is an asset, but it doesn't have to be the entire campaign. The action, scale, supporting cast and world of Gunmaaster G9 can gradually become the selling points. That is a healthier way to build a theatrical film. And then there is Emraan Hashmi The renewed interest in Hashmi is perhaps less about a comeback and more about rediscovery. He has never really disappeared. He has continued to work across films and streaming, taking on protagonists, supporting parts and antagonistic roles. What has become less frequent is seeing him positioned as the primary theatrical draw. Awarapan 2 has changed that conversation. His performance has been among the elements audiences have responded to, reaffirming that the qualities that made Hashmi distinctive vulnerability, intensity and an understated screen presence haven't disappeared with age. In fact, they may work differently now. Hashmi doesn't need to compete with younger actors on their terms. He has reached a stage where his lived-in quality can actually become part of his appeal. And Gunmaaster G9, with its action-oriented positioning, gives him a genre in which that maturity could work particularly well. The real test begins with G9 It is tempting to call Awarapan 2 a comeback. But perhaps comeback is too simplistic. One successful film doesn't restore an actor to a particular position in the industry. What it does is reopen possibilities. Gunmaaster G9 is one of those possibilities. The film will arrive without the built-in advantage of an Awarapan legacy. There won't be the same nostalgia to lean on. There won't be the immediate afterglow of Awarapan 2. It will have to create its own reason for audiences to buy a ticket. That makes its November 2026 release all the more interesting. If G9 works, the conversation around Hashmi changes from Emraan is still relevant to something far more meaningful: Emraan has found another theatrical lane. That is the opportunity sitting in front of Mukut, Hashmi and the G9 team. No need for a comeback story Perhaps the most encouraging thing about Gunmaaster G9 is that nobody needs to sell it as Emraan Hashmi's grand comeback. He doesn't need one. He needs a strong character, a compelling film and the right theatrical positioning. Awarapan 2 has reminded audiences that they are willing to watch him. Now Gunmaaster G9 has the time and, importantly, the distance to give them a completely new reason to do so. For a film announced more than a year ahead of its release, that may actually be the smartest part of the strategy. The 14th edition of Rajnigandha Presents Jagran Film Festival, the world's largest travelling film festival, is set to return to New Delhi from August 20 to 23, 2026, at the Dr. Ambedkar International Centre. The four-day festival will bring together filmmakers, actors, creators and cinema enthusiasts for a series of screenings, conversations, masterclasses, panel discussions and special events. The Delhi chapter will mark the beginning of another nationwide journey celebrating films and diverse cinematic voices from India and around the world. The festival will open with the world premiere of Shikayatein, marking the film's first public screening. Starring Jaaved Jaaferi and Sayani Gupta, the drama explores relationships, unresolved emotions and the burdens people carry through life. With its focus on human emotions and relationships, Shikayatein will set the stage for this year's festival. The Delhi chapter will conclude with Lost & Found Kumbh, a film set against the backdrop of the Kumbh Mela. Exploring themes of faith, hope and human connection, the film follows individuals whose lives intersect during one of the world's largest gatherings. The film will bring the Delhi edition to a close with a story rooted in human experiences and cultural settings. Talking about the world premiere of Shikayatein at JFF, Jaaved Jaaferi said, A film lives through so many stages before it finally reaches its audience, so having the world premiere of Shikayatein at the Jagran Film Festival feels incredibly special. It's a wonderful way for the entire team to see years of hard work come alive on the big screen. JFF has built a reputation for bringing together people who genuinely appreciate good cinema, and I'm looking forward to being there, celebrating this milestone with everyone and watching the audience experience the film for the very first time. With its line-up of screenings, masterclasses, panel discussions and special events, JFF 2026 will bring together filmmakers and audiences in New Delhi before continuing its journey across India.
